The Hidden Affliction – Sexually Transmitted Infections and Infertility in History: Rochester Studies in Medical History

Autor Simon Szreter, Adrien Minard, Charlotte Roberts, Christina Benninghaus, Fabrice Cahen
en Limba Engleză Hardback – 30 sep 2019
Multidisciplinary collection of essays on the relationship of infertility and the "historic" STIs--gonorrhea, chlamydia, and syphilis--producing surprising new insights in studies from across the globe and spanning millennia.
